UBC is seeking a Research Ethics Review Associate to facilitate ethical evaluations of research proposals submitted to the UBC Okanagan Behavioural Research Ethics Board. The role involves ensuring compliance with ethical standards and providing guidance to researchers on policy requirements

Job Summary

  • The position is responsible for facilitating whether research study proposals submitted primarily to the UBC Okanagan Behavioural Research Ethics Board (BREB) are acceptable on ethical grounds by implementing and monitoring ethical review processes and standards.
  • This position must be pro-active in identifying and rectifying any weaknesses in compliance with the TCPS2 and other national ethical and legislative standards for research ethics.
  • The position has significant influence on the quality and effectiveness of the services provided by UBC’s REBs, and errors in judgment could have a significant impact on the incumbent's ability to carry out the functions of the position effectively.
